Durham's day-to-day fact for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 levels with sidewalk that french fries paws rapidly. Pollen spikes can cause itch flare in spring. We also obtain cold snaps with freezing rainfall that turn walkways unsafe. Good pet dog walkers prepare around all of it. They begin earlier in warmth, usage sh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, switch to sniffy decompression walks in tree cover, and reduce lunchtime stretches if required. When ice strikes, they choose much professional dog walking company safer paths, wipe paws, and look for salt irritation.

The constructed atmosphere shapes options too. Downtown has tighter pathways and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er cul-de-sacs and loops with fully grown trees. The American Cigarette Path is wonderful for directly, consistent mileage, but it can be busy with bikes. A smart dog walker reviews the map, then reads your canine, and integrates both to get the appropriate sort of exercise.

The top 7 advantages of working with a specialist dog walker in Durham

1. Constant, reproduce ideal workout that fits the season

Every dog needs motion, however not the same kind or dosage. A 9 years of age b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ie demands. An expert dog strolling solution brings that calibration. In summertime,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ive herding types to unethical, quit and smell paths near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, then do any kind of cardio work in the cooler evening port. Senior pets get short, frequent potty brake with mild walks and rest. On light autumn days, we extend period and terrain, using ground cover and brand-new fragrances as mind work.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and remainder improves endurance without straining joints or getting too hot, specifically crucial on moist days that jeopardize cooling.

2. Midday alleviation, healthier food digestion, less accidents

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health boost with regular relief. Young puppies under six months seldom make it longer than four hours without a break, despite how much you wish they could. Lots of grown-up canines can hold it, but at a price, particularly seniors or those on certain drugs. Trustworthy midday walks minimize urinary tract infection danger and assist regulate bowel movements. In my notes, families with a constant 20 to half an hour noontime walk saw interior accidents drop to near zero within 2 weeks, even for recently embraced pets who were still clearing up in. That predictability lowers stress and anxiety and prevents the type of frantic energy that develops when a pet needs to wait too long.

3. Better actions with targeted psychological work

A tired canine is a misconception if all you do is run them till their legs totter. The brain needs a work. Excellent dog pedestrians make use of scent video games at trailheads, pattern games at peaceful edges, and basic impulse control on leash to bring arousal down, after that keep it there. We will request for a sit and eye contact at hectic cr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ive tranquility while a bus goes by, and tip off the pathway for room if a skateboard approaches. Ten calculated repetitions done well issue greater than a frenzied mile. In time, drawing decreases, reactivity softens, and your pet finds out just how to recuperate from sudden sound or groups. That settles in reality, like outdoor meals at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social self-confidence without chaos

Everyone photos their dog going for a park with a dozen new pals. Some thrive there, some obtain overloaded, and a couple of learn negative routines fast. Expert canine pedestrians in Durham, NC Same-day dog walking availability manage social exposure strategically. If a dog delights in firm, we couple compatible walking buddies by dimension, energy, and chain good manners, keep groups tiny, and pick routes with adequate size for comfy side by side motion, like areas of Fight it out Forest where allowed. For pet dogs who like room, we set up solo walks and route them at off peak times. The end result is social self-confidence improved positive, controlled experiences, not required proximity.

5. Early discovery of wellness problems and safer walks

Walkers spend time seeing your dog move, sniff, and get rid of on a daily basis. That repeating exposes little modifications. We notice the head bob that recommends a sore wrist, a new hitch in the hips on stairs, the means a normally steady belly creates soft feces 2 days running. A message with a fast video commonly prompts a precautionary vet visit that conserves bigger difficulty later on. Safety and Drop-in visits for dogs security awareness expands beyond the dog. Durham has urban wildlife, from hawks to the odd prairie wolf discovery at dawn near woody sides. We maintain pets on chain per neighborhood guidelines, scan for foxtails and burrs, carry tick removers, and prevent hot asphalt at midday. I have actually rescheduled walks to shaded loopholes extra times than I can count when a warm consultatory hit, and owners thanked me later.

6. Genuine ease for difficult schedules

Shifts alter. A conference runs long. A kid awakens with a fever. A dog strolling service soaks up that unpredictability. Most established pet walkers in Durham supply timetable home windows, same day add if you book early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a couple of photos, and a brief note about state of mind, poop, and anything remarkable. Even if you are in a laboratory or scrubbed in, you can eye your phone and understand your pet dog is covered. The mental lift is actual. Customers usually say the updates help them focus at the workplace, after that walk in the door all set to appreciate the evening instead of scramble to take care of a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a canine's requirements are satisfied accurately, they bark less at squirrels, chew less shoes, and resolve faster after supper. That alters the feeling of your home.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We set a thirty minutes smell stroll at 11, then a 15 min potty brake with 2 short training video games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ors stopped texting concerning noise. They started inviting pals over once again. The pet learned that every day has beats, and anxiety shed its grip.

What a specialist pet dog strolling solution generally provides in Durham

Service menus differ, however you will certainly see patterns across the better pet strolling solutions in Durham, NC. Basic go to sizes h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some offer 45 minutes, which works well in severe climate or for pets that do ideal with a quick loop and a couple of minutes of indoor play. A lot of firms use a scheduling application that verifies time windows, logs the stroll route, and lets you update feeding or medicine notes.

Solo strolls match reactive, senior, or clinically complex dogs. Combined or small group walks can decrease price and add secure social time, yet ask what team size suggests in practice. I hardly ever see more than 2 pets per walker on city walkways. Three is a tough limitation I recommend for trails with broad courses. Off chain journeys sound exciting, yet true off chain is uncommon in Durham because of leash laws and security. A trustworthy dog walker will maintain your dog leashed unless on personal property with authorization, and they will certainly inform you that up front.

Expect basic equipment monitoring, like wiping paws after rainfall, refreshing water, and towel drying out if required. A lot of walkers bring a tiny set, poop bags, extra slip lead, a collapsible water bowl, and paw balm in wintertime. Keys are kept in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ance policy ought to cover vital loss. If your pet dog needs lunchtime medicine, confirm the service's plan on carrying out pills or decreases. Numerous will certainly do it, yet they will desire an authorized direction sheet and maybe a fast dem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ates move with experience, insurance, and check out size. In Durham, a 20 min see commonly lands between 18 and 28 bucks, a thirty minutes go to in between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ute see in between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a second canine can be a little cost, usually 3 to 8 dollars, depending upon the size and taking care of requirements. Weekend, holiday, or late evening slots might lug additional charges. Solo reactive pet getaways cost more than a relaxed paired walk, not due to the fact that anyone is punishing the pet dog, however because two hands, two eyes, and a large buffer are committed to one animal.

Be cautious of rates that seem also reduced. Employees need training, time padding for emergencies, and remainder. A lasting dog strolling service pays fairly, maintains insurance coverage, and can soak up the periodic flat tire without terminating your canine's day.

How to select the best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search results page app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not require a postgraduate degree to do it well. Begin with insurance and experience, after that view exactly how a walker connects with your dog and with you. Take notice of the small things, like preparation at the fulfill and greet and the clearness of their interaction. Ask for recommendations from customers with dogs comparable to yours, not just beautiful generalities.

Here is a compact checklist that keeps the basics front and center:

  • Proof of service insurance policy, bonding, and workers' compensation if they have workers, plus a clear plan for secrets or lockboxes.
  • Training approach that makes use of rewards and humane handling, with specifics on just how they take care of pulling, barking, or sudden lunges.
  • Experience with your pet dog's profile, for instance, huge teen pet dogs, seniors with arthritis, or leash responsive dogs.
  • Clear see framework, timing home windows, and back-up strategy if your primary walker is ill or stuck, with GPS or image updates.
  • Transparent pricing, cancellation terms, holiday additional charges, and just how they handle extreme heat, tornados, or ice.

When you satisfy, view your dog. A great walker gives a pet dog room to smell and approach first, kneels sideways rather than impending, and avoids harsh patting immediately. They handle leashes efficiently, check harness fit, and ask where your canine suches as to go. If your canine is reluctant or responsive, a silent very first go to without pressure to walk much may be the best call.

Interview questions and five refined red flags

You will have your own list of concerns. Include a couple of that relocation past the site gloss. Ask to explain a recent walk that did not most likely to strategy and what they altered. Ask exactly how they would certainly heat up a high power pet dog on a humid day to avoid getting too hot. Ask for a short demo of just how they take care of a pull towards a squirrel. Responses that seem resided in are what you want.

Watch for these warnings that usually predict migraines later:

  • Vague or prideful answers about insurance policy or emergency planning.
  • Reliance on aversive tools without your consent, such as sliding prong collars or making use of chain stands out as a default.
  • Overpromising, like walking 4 or five dogs at the same time on downtown sidewalks, or assuring that a reactive pet will be fine in big groups within a week.
  • Thin interaction, late replies throughout the trial week, or irregular stroll home windows with no heads up.
  • Indifference to weather changes, like demanding lengthy noontime asphalt strolls during a warm advisory.

Three common situations, and just how a good dog walker adapts

A 6 month old young pu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is mainly there, but lunchtime is unsteady. The pedestrian sets 2 noontime gos to for the initial 2 weeks, a 15 minute alleviation at 11 and a 20 min walk at 2 with two easy training video games. They reduce the stroll on warm days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ner goes down to one thirty minutes midday check out since the pet dog is reliably holding in between 10 and 3.

A reactive guard near Southpoint. The canine l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ker picks quieter roads at 10 a.m., then uses distance from triggers, fulfilling check ins. They maintain the canine at the edge of convenience and never press via reactivity. Over 4 to six we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not excellent, yet practical, and the owner really feels secure again.

An elderly beagle midtown with creaky hips. Stairways are hard in the morning. The pedestrian times visits after discomfort meds, makes use of a rear harness aid if needed, and chooses flat loops with lawn sh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the belly throughout warm. The canine returns home content, not limping, and the proprietor's veterinarian records secure weight and far better mobility.

Weather, safety, and reasonable expectations

Durham summer seasons will certainly test even in shape pet dogs. On 95 degree days with high humidity, your pet dog does not need range, they need safe engagement. A 15 to 20 min shaded sniff walk with water and a cool off towel inside is typically the best telephone call. Great services connect these modifications and do not excuse safeguarding your canine. Furthermore, throughout electrical storms, lots of pets stop at the door. Forcing them out produces fights. A pedestrian ought to pivot to interior enrichment, potty ideally during time-outs,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and building and construction change swiftly around here. Pathway closures pop up without warning. I have actually turned an arranged loop right into a cul-de-sac figure eight simply to prevent a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et obtains five solid mins of loose chain method, three tranquil ex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is an effective noontime visit on a loud day.
